The Sentosa case is one of the many cases that highlight the trend of exploitation of Filipino labor in America through contract fraud and work trafficking. Carlos Bulosan was promised socioeconomic when he came to the US in pursuit of the American dream during the 1930s. Soon after moving to America, he realized that for him, the American dream would be just that—a dream. He constantly experienced racial discrimination and was forced to endure severely underpaid working conditions.

Recent history shows a continuous trend of American industries to exploit workers of Filipino descent.
